Peranakan's search for national identity : biographical studies of seven Indonesian Chinese / = biographical studies of seven Indonesian Chinese /
Record Type:
Language materials, printed : Monograph/item
Title/Author:
Peranakan's search for national identity : biographical studies of seven Indonesian Chinese // Leo Suryadinata.
Reminder of title:
biographical studies of seven Indonesian Chinese /
remainder title:
Biographical studies of seven Indonesian Chinese
Author:
Suryadinata, Leo.
Published:
Singapore :Marshall Cavendish Academic, : 2004,
Description:
xi, 162 p. :ill. ;23 cm.
Notes:
First published: Singapore : Times Academic Press, 1993.
[NT 15003449]:
Tjoe Bou San, a Chinese nationalist who died young -- Kwee Hing Tjiat, Chinese nationalist and assimilationist figure -- Kwee Tek Hoay, a peranakan writer and proponent of Tridharma -- Liem Koen Hian, a peranakan who searched for political identity -- Kwee Kek Beng, the dilemma of a peranakan supporter of Chinese nationalism -- Abdul Karim Oey, a Chinese Muslim of Muhammadiyah -- Yap Thiam Hien, an unyielding defender of human rights -- Ethnic and national identities of the Chinese in Indonesia.
